  3. BSOD Machine Check Exception

    Hey everyone,

    This BSOD has become a daily thing now and it always happens while I am playing a particular game (Skyforge). The crash is fairly random from as quick as 5 minutes to as long as couple of hours while playing the game. I noticed that 'Windowed Mode' of the
    game helps delay the BSOD but it is still disappointing as this is a relatively new system and to have BSODs at the start is just :/ I run a MSI GE62 2QD Apache Pro and have not altered anything since I purchased it ~6 months ago (aside from clearing bloatwares).
    It was pre-installed with Windows 8.1 and I have tried the following in sequence:

    1. Updating drivers via Windows Update and via MSI Support page

    2. Updating to the latest Nvidia Graphic Driver

    -The following changed the BSOD from Machine Check Exception to Driver_IRQL_Not_Less_Than_Or_Equal bwcW8x64.sys which relates to a variety of .sys files including but not limited to (acpiex.sys, rdyboost.sys, bwcW8x64.sys, etc.)

    3. Uninstalled the latest Nvidia Graphic Driver and allowed Windows to automatically reinstall Nvidia Graphics Driver

    -Back to Machine Check Exception

    4. Cleaned all my fans, reseated RAM, fans are working

    5. Monitored my temps, usually in the range of 40-60 (can reach 70~80 sometimes but this only lasts couple of seconds?)

    6. Stressed test with Prime95 for 6 hours, no errors

    7. Reinstalled Skyforge

    8. Ran Driver Verifier

    -Windows BSOD constantly, driver localised to hal.dll +37745 and ntoskrnl.exe (sadly I have lost the driver file because of 9)

    9. Upgrade AND clean install to Windows 10

    -BSOD again Machine Check Exception within minutes of game (hal.dll +364b1)
